NY Intergroup Fellowship Of The Spirit New York Annual Conference

Calendar
When:
May 20, 2022 @ 3:00 pm – May 22, 2022 @ 3:00 pm America/New York Timezone
2022-05-20T15:00:00-04:00
2022-05-22T15:00:00-04:00
Where:
Stony Point Center
17 Cricketown Rd
Stony Point, NY 10980
USA
Live NYIntergroup

for more information visit NY Intergroup event page
